Rock Island Arsenal produced M1903 rifles from 1904–1913 and 1917–1919, totaling over 400,000 units. Rock Island 1903 rifles are prized for their history, with earlier models having single heat-treat receivers and later, safer models featuring double heat-treat, usually above serial number 285,507. These .30-06 rifles were often refurbished during WWI and WWII with Parkerized finishes, with some designated as 1903A1 when fitted with Type C pistol grip stocks. Key details:
